MOA
Akniclav Plus Oral Drops is an antibiotic. It has two active agents, amoxycillin and clavulanic acid. Amoxycillin works by preventing the formation of the bacterial protective covering (cell wall) essential for the survival of the bacteria. Whereas, clavulanic acid serves a special purpose of inhibiting an enzyme (beta-lactamase) that is produced by resistant bacteria. This makes the combination of amoxycillin and clavulanic acid an effective line of treatment for many types of infections.

Drug Tips
Your child must complete the entire course of antibiotics. Stopping too soon may cause the bacteria to multiply again, become resistant, or cause another infection.
Your child may have a bitter taste in the mouth after the intake of Akniclav Plus Oral Drops. Eating citrus fruit or sipping plenty of water or fruit juice may help.
Encourage your child to drink plenty of water in case diarrhea develops as a side effect.
Never give Akniclav Plus Oral Drops until and unless prescribed by the doctor. You must also never share your childโs medicine with anyone else even if they show similar symptoms.
Do not give Akniclav Plus Oral Drops to treat common cold and flu-like symptoms caused by viruses.
Never save medicine for future illnesses. It cannot be said whether the same medicine will work on future infections.
Check โexpiryโ before giving Akniclav Plus Oral Drops to your child. Immediately discard all the expired medicines.
Stop Akniclav Plus Oral Drops immediately if your child develops an itchy rash, facial swelling, or breathing difficulty. Report to the doctor without any delay.ย

Q. Do all viral common colds result in secondary bacterial infection?
Most of the time, bacterial infections do not follow viral infections. In fact, giving antibiotics in viral infection can increase your childโs risk of developing side effects. So, use antibiotics only after consulting with your childโs doctor.
Q. The mucus coming out of my childโs nose is yellow-green. Is it a sign of a bacterial infection?
Yellow or green mucus in the nose does not mean that antibiotics are needed. During a common cold, it is normal for mucus to thicken up and change from clear to yellow or green. Symptoms often last for 7-10 days.

Safety Profile
Kidney:CAUTION
Akniclav Plus Oral Drops should be used with caution in patients with kidney disease. Dose adjustment of Akniclav Plus Oral Drops may be needed. Please consult your doctor.The dose also needs to be reduced in neonates and infants due to incompletely developed renal function.
Liver:CAUTION
Akniclav Plus Oral Drops should be used with caution in patients with liver disease. Dose adjustment of Akniclav Plus Oral Drops may be needed. Please consult your doctor.Regular monitoring of liver function tests is recommended while you are taking this medicine
